Stop Light Switch: Installation

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2012 Subaru Forester.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Install the stop light switch onto the bracket with screws and position it with the nut.
  2. Adjust the stop light switch position, and then tighten the nut.

    < Ref. to ADJUSTMENT , Stop Light Switch . >

    Tightening torque: 

    8 N.m (0.8 kgf-m, 5.9 ft-lb)
